Summary

On April 18, 2010, a 44-year-old woman goes missing in Anchorage, Alaska. As far as her husband is concerned, there are multiple versions of where she is. Some, including the woman’s own mother, are told that she’s died of cancer. Others are told she’s relocated out of state. Finally, a concerned friend contacts law enforcement as things continue to fail to add up. When charges are laid for the woman’s murder, the true extent of the killer’s motive and how far they would go to silence someone with knowledge about other shocking crimes being committed is revealed, much to the disgust of those close to them, as well as the community. In episode 314, Jac and Alexis detail the devastating murder of Angela Dixiano, and the brutal lengths to which some people will go to conceal a calculated pattern of offending that exploits and manipulates society’s most vulnerable.
